Djokovic, Nadal advance to third round at Indian Wells

2016_3$largeimg14_Monday_2016_193243124Indian Wells, USA, March 14

Defending champion Novak Djokovic and Spanish tennis maestro Rafael Nadal produced contrasting performances as they progressed through to the third round of the Indian Wells Masters after their respective wins in the men’s singles event here on Monday.
Top seed Djokovic overcame a shaky start to trounce local boy Bjorn Fratangelo 2-6, 6-1, 6-2 in the second round contest that lasted one hour and 46 minutes.
Meanwhile, 14-time Grand Slam champion Nadal was also made to work hard for his 6-2, 2-6, 6-4 win over Gilles Muller of Luxembourg in the second round.
